About the Nikko Toshogu shrine Yomei-mon
Yomei-mon is a superb building of Nikko Toshogu shrine which was rebuilt from 1634 to 1636 by the command of Tokugawa Iemitsu.
Designated as a National Treasure of Japan in June 1951, UNESCO World Cultural Heritage was registered in December 1999.
It is decorated with fine decorations and sculptures and is famous as a gate built with the best craft decoration technology at the time.
